摘要
New oligomeric cyclic silylcarbodiimides 1-3 are synthesised by the reaction dichlorosilanes with cyanamide. From the resulting reaction mixture with dichloro-dimethylsilane the tetrameric compound of the hypothetical [(CH3)(2)Si=N-CN] is isolated. In this molecule sixteen atoms build a nearly planar ring structure with a special steric arrangement of the groups. This oligomeric silylcarbodiimides present a new kind of precursors for the pyrolytic synthesis of ceramics in the ternary system SiCN.
